problem #2

Jun 152003

F-350

  • Automatic transmission
  • 85,953 miles
The trans always felt funny but the dealer said it was normal.I have had the dealer service the trans every 30,000 miles and between services trans was drained every 15,000 miles and had new trans fluid. I have a orange taged transmission and I was told by the dealer it had to be replaced.the 4R100 trans and the E40D have had a high premature failure and Ford in my opinion is operating under deceptive practices by keep selling trucks with a known defect. I was told by one dealer the trans has a 90% chance of failure. Ford wants between $3,200 and $3,800 to replace the trans.
